Nanocomposite synthesis of silver doped magnesium oxide incorporated in PVC matrix for photocatalytic applications

This work reveals a sol–gel approach for synthesis of silver doped magnesium oxide (Ag:MgO) incorporated in PVC matrix to give Ag:MgO/PVC nanocomposite. On glass substrate three different percentages (3,7, and 10%) were deposited by spin coating method. film nanocomposites characterized using AFM, UV–Vis, XRD FTIR analysis. The results revealed the formation Ag MgO nanoparticles with two phases (MgO metallic Ag) average size equal 31.5,22.29, 23.77, 29.68 nm. direct band gap energy pure MgO/PVC was 4.1 eV 3.85 respectively. value changes from eV, 3.75 3.71 3.69 increasing Ag:MgO concentration(3–10%). Atomic force microscopyalso shows change roughness percentage. photocatalytic activity this nanocomposite evaluated methylene blue (MB) dye under UV light irradiation. result demonstrated good potential films MB degradation suitable reaction proposed mechanism. kinetic studies rate constant 6.25 × 10–3 min−1 10% thin films.
